@WildYoungParents & @TrifleGatheringProductions released a music video to challenge stigma & raise awareness of MH issues facing young parents.
Written & performed by young parents, the production is a response to the judgement & loss of identity felt by parents under 23 years youtu.be/OLAcWox4Z9A
